In Loving Memory of Zachary “Zack” William Young: A Life of Humor, Love, and Strength

MURFREESBORO, TENNESSEE — The tight-knit community of Murfreesboro is mourning the tragic and sudden loss of Zachary William Young, known to friends and family as Zack, who passed away on August 7, 2025, at the age of 32. Zack’s life was unexpectedly cut short due to a devastating motorcycle accident, leaving an irreplaceable void in the hearts of all who knew and loved him.

Family and Loved Ones

Zack was predeceased by his grandparents Joan and Franz Kopper, his grandfather Harvey Young, and his mother Laurie Young Colaprete. He is survived by his close family members and a wide circle of friends who now carry the weight of his memory with heavy hearts.
